- Length: 298 pages
- Publication Date: 2018-04-20
- Length: 360 pages
- Publication Date: 2017-06-28
- Length: 472 pages
- Publication Date: 2017-03-06
- Length: 382 pages
- Publication Date: 2018-02-28
- Length: 210 pages
- Publication Date: 2018-06-30
- Length: 608 pages
- Publication Date: 2018-02-27
- Length: 454 pages
- Publication Date: 2018-02-15
- Length: 384 pages
- Publication Date: 2014-12-31
- Length: 400 pages
- Publication Date: 2011-10-17
- Length: 456 pages
- Publication Date: 2014-04-14
- Length: 211 pages
- Publication Date: 2016-09-21
- Length: 215 pages
- Publication Date: 2014-08-04